10 Simple Steps to Eliminate Geckos

Have you ever ever discovered your self in a battle in opposition to these sneaky, elusive creatures referred to as geckos? These tiny reptiles is usually a nuisance, scurrying round your property and abandoning droppings. For those who’re bored with the gecko invasion, it is time to take motion. On this complete information, we’ll unveil … Read more